A 1964 Ford Fairlane sold for $700,000 at the recent Barrett-Jackson’s 4th Annual Las Vegas auto auction and the Armed Forces Foundation benefited from the proceeds of the sale. Painted in the “Red Hot Chili Pepper” hue from the Sherwin- Williams Planet Color Barrett-Jackson Collector Color Series, the car was the top-selling vehicle of the event.

The winning bidder showed his gratitude to those serving in the American military and their families, with one-hundred percent of the sale’s proceeds benefiting the Armed Forces Foundation, a national non-profit organization that provides support for wounded service members and their families, through Project American Heroes. Additionally, Barrett- Jackson waived its commissions on the sale, as it has on all charity sales in recent years.

“Our men and women in uniform are on the front lines every day, and their families are continually called upon to put others first. We at Barrett-Jackson feel strongly about this incredible group of people and amazing charity, and that’s why I am willing to give up one of my prized possessions to show how thankful I am,” said Steve Davis, President of Barrett- Jackson, and (previous) owner of the Fairlane.

The car underwent hundreds of hours of restoration and detailing, and was a showstopper at the 2009 SEMA convention, where it was displayed at the Sherwin- Williams Automotive Finishes booth. It features a Roush Performance 427IR, 8-stack fuel injection 560 HP engine with a torque of 540 ft-lbs and a Tremec TKO 6 speed.

Its custom finish comes from the Sherwin-Williams Planet Color Barrett-Jackson Collector Color series – a line of optically enhanced automotive paints containing special combinations of highly reflective additives. The color, “Red Hot Chili Pepper” (#PCFP2), is one of 25 colors in the factory package, custom paint line.
